Critical Evaluation
Value of the Information & Strength of the Argument
The video provides substantial value by synthesizing current scientific knowledge and mission plans for Europa Clipper. It clearly explains the evidence for Europa’s ocean, the mission’s objectives, and the technical challenges. The argumentation is solid, based on official NASA sources and scientific literature, and presents a balanced view of uncertainties, such as the thickness of the ice shell. The inclusion of potential complementary missions (cubesats, lander) adds depth and forward-looking perspective.

Key Moments
Markers derived by PSI from the transcript: the creator did not define chapters.
- Introduction to the Europa Clipper mission and its context within the exploration of Jupiter's moons.
- Explanation of the evidence for Europa's subsurface ocean, including magnetic field data from Galileo.
- Discussion of tidal heating as the mechanism for maintaining the ocean in a liquid state.
- Overview of the mission's flyby strategy and the challenges of Jupiter's radiation environment.
- Description of the scientific instruments on board Europa Clipper and their objectives.
- Exploration of potential complementary missions, including cubesats and a lander, and the significance of geysers.
